John: Is Hamburg still using bubinga in their blocks? Would you recommend using a Hamburg block rather than the NY in a Hamburg D? We just removed the block and are replacing it with a NY block. Thanks for the info! John Minor University of Illinois On Tue, 22 Aug 2000, Patton, John wrote: ]Yes, their pinblock is primarily laminated quartersawn maple, with a couple ]of layers of bubinga. Don't know the exact dimensions or total number of ]layers. I may have a reference sheet somewhere. If not, we'll get one. BTW, ]Hamburg is using our maple rim stock, but continues to put a layer or two of ]bubinga in that as well. According to Hartwig, they are just using it up. ]Their soundboard material is Sitka that we supply, ribs are spruce, and they ]crown them.
